Commercial Slab Installation in Lansing, MI
Commercial slab installation services involve preparing and pouring concrete foundations or floors for various types of property projects. This service is commonly used for constructing new commercial buildings, parking lots, loading docks, storage facilities, and other large-scale structures that require a stable, level surface.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of the project, including the planning process, the materials used, and how the slab will support the intended use of the space. Additionally, it’s important to consider factors like site preparation, drainage, and the overall durability of the concrete to ensure the finished slab meets long-term needs.
Before requesting commercial slab installation, property owners should evaluate the size and layout of the area, as well as any specific requirements related to load capacity or environmental conditions. Understanding the local building codes and permitting processes can also help streamline the project. Clear communication about the desired outcome and any particular concerns-such as future expansion or access points-can contribute to a successful installation that provides a solid foundation for ongoing operations.

Common Commercial Slab Installation Jobs
Commercial slab installation involves pouring and setting concrete for building foundations and flooring.
Parking lot slabs create durable surfaces for vehicle access and traffic flow.
Loading dock slabs provide strong, level surfaces for freight handling operations.
Sidewalk and walkway slabs enhance accessibility and safety around commercial properties.
Industrial flooring slabs support heavy machinery and high-traffic environments.
Foundation slabs serve as the base for various commercial structures and extensions.
Commercial Slab Installation Questions
What types of projects require commercial slab installation? Commercial slab installation is often needed for building fo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and storage areas on commercial properties.
What materials are commonly used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the standard material used for commercial slabs due to its durability and strength.
How does site preparation impact commercial slab installation? Proper site preparation ensures a stable, level surface, which is essential for the longevity and performance of the slab.
What should property owners consider before installing a commercial slab? It’s important to assess the intended use, load requirements, and drainage needs to select the best slab design and thickness.
